Albion suffered a 1-0 defeat to Everton at Goodison Park.

Richarlison gave Everton the lead in the 38th minute, when he got on the end of Lucas Digne’s cross, before twisting and turning and curling an effort into the bottom corner.

In the 54th minute, Leandro Trossard went within inches of drawing Albion level, when he got the ball on the left flank and cut inside before curling an effort which came off the crossbar.

In the 77th minute, Dominic Calvert-Lewin thought he had doubled Everton’s lead when he put the ball into an empty net after Michael Keane’s header had come off the crossbar.

However, VAR ruled it out for a handball by the striker as he knocked the ball in with his arm.

Substitute Glenn Murray was then superbly denied when his header from Trossard’s cross was well saved by Jordan Pickford.

Murray again went close late on when Neal Maupay played the ball into him, but he could only toe-poke his effort just inches wide of the goal.
